Upgrade to a lithium battery mobility scooter to boost the performance of your scooter. Lithium batteries offer more power that is consistent throughout the discharge cycle. They also have an integrated BMS to prevent overcharge.

Lightweight

A lithium battery is an excellent option for mobility scooters. Not only are they lighter and more compact, but they also provide a longer battery lifespan and have greater energy efficiency than lead batteries. They also can endure more frequent charging cycles. The lithium battery is free of harmful chemicals like lead or cadmium.

Lithium mobility scooter batteries are the latest advancement in mobility scooter technology. They are lighter than traditional batteries and make the scooter more transportable. They also have a higher efficiency in energy use and can extend their range on one charge. The battery is protected by a battery management system that helps to monitor the condition of the battery, and also prevent damage or over-charging.

Batteries are designed to last for up to 12 years with minimal maintenance. To ensure that they are safe and performing optimally, you should charge and discharge the batteries according to the instructions of the manufacturer. It is also important not to let the batteries to overheat or even freeze. This could permanently damage the cells of the battery.

These batteries are smaller, lighter and more powerful than other options such as sealed lead and gel acid batteries. These batteries also provide better value for money over the long term. When buying a brand new battery, take into consideration the size, voltage, and the cycle life. The cycle life is the many times a battery could be discharged and charged without having to be replaced. The life span of lithium batteries is superior to other types, like sealed lead acid batteries.

Lithium is the lightest metal on the planet, and it can store more energy than other batteries in its size. It can hold 150 watts per kilogram which is an improvement over the lead-acid battery that is that is used in a lot of mobility devices. Furthermore, lithium batteries do not contain harmful chemicals such as lead or cadmium, which are commonly utilized in other kinds of batteries. In addition, they are free of odor and don't leak. These features make them perfect for mobility scooters and electric wheelchairs.

Longer Lifespan

The life span of a mobility scooter battery can be affected by the how it is used, the often and for how long. It is also affected by the environment it is located in, specifically extreme temperatures. The general rule is that a scooter with lithium batteries has a much longer life span than one with lead acid batteries.

This is mainly due to the fact that lithium batteries are more efficient than traditional lead acid batteries. They are also lighter, which contributes to a greater range of your mobility scooter. The lithium batteries can keep more power in them and can extend their range with just one charge.

Traditionally, most mobility scooters are powered by gel or sealed lead acid batteries. These batteries are prone to failure and require regular maintenance to extend their lifespan. A mobility scooter that has lithium batteries has a significantly longer lifespan and requires little or no maintenance to maintain their performance.

It is crucial to charge your mobility scooter battery fully every day. It is also an ideal idea to unplug the charger after the charge cycle is complete. This reduces the depth of each discharge and recharge cycle, increasing the battery's lifespan.

It is also important to avoid overcharging the batteries in your mobility scooters, as this can reduce their life span. It is best to use the charger that came with your mobility scooter, because it is the best appropriate for your model and will charge your batteries most efficiently.
